Output 58edcd6e2161df0688878177160b8d84c1cadb2673811f2a2d80661bb94b4e09:0

value
13881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c4eec7045c851d135c68926250c1c542f927a9a OP_EQUAL
address
3FwVtBBTaYhfSrWZEsKM2D54JNxooYNYbS
transaction
58edcd6e2161df0688878177160b8d84c1cadb2673811f2a2d80661bb94b4e09
spent
true